Hi John, I bought an upholstery kit for my TD a few years ago. I took it to a trimmer so he could fit the seat covers properly. He had to adjust the covers so they were a snug fit and he said it would have been cheaper to let him make the whole lot from scratch. At least there are no carriage costs via this route. Just a wee point of interest for you - the trimmer had spent 20 years working in Australia on classic cars before returning to Scotland. Jan T |
